Thucydides, born in 460 BC, was an Athenian historian and an important figure of the Classical Greece He has written the “History of the Peloponnesian War”, that was one of the first works of its kind, and a major source of information about Ancient Greece. Thucydides was one of the first to describe the cause of a conflict, analyzing the geopolitical reasons and psychological events that brought it about. Furthermore, he made a profound analysis of the choices and moral decisions that each player did during a war. Thucydides is widely known for his oblique description of events, that did not only focused on the military aspects, but also got into the ethical and moral aspects of a conflict.
